What is the difference between heat and temperature?

Heat is the transfer of thermal energy, while temperature measures how hot or cold an object is.

What causes tectonic plates to move?

Convection currents in the Earth's mantle.

Why does sweating help cool the body?

Water evaporates from the skin, taking thermal energy away and cooling the body.

Explain why a metal spoon left in a hot cup of tea becomes hot.

Thermal energy is transferred through the spoon by conduction from the hot end to the cooler end.

Two waves have the same amplitude, but one has twice the frequency of the other. How will their sounds differ?

They will have the same loudness, but the higher-frequency wave will have a higher pitch.

Scientists believe an asteroid contributed to the extinction of the dinosaurs. Explain how an asteroid impact could cause global climate change.

Dust and debris block sunlight, reducing temperatures and photosynthesis, disrupting food chains and causing widespread extinction.
